O-I Supports Global Operations With Chinese Mould Plant

O-I is targeting Chinese growth after opening a glass mould manufacturing facility in the country that will supply its global operations. O-I, which also has a mould facility in Brazil, said the O-I Tianjin Mould facility would help cement China as one of "the pillars of our business going forward." CE Al Stroucken said: "I am convinced that maintaining our position as the world's leading glass container supplier will depend on achieving that position here in the Chinese market as well." The facility is located 120km southeast of Beijing & employs around 300 people. It produces round & shaped moulds/blanks, as well as finish equipment. The facility is a joint venture with Yi Qing. Each mould can be used to make more than 2M containers.
